When you're first exposed to Dutch, you might notice that some letters are pronounced differently than in English. For example, the letter 'j' sounds like a 'y' in English, and the 'g' can sound like you're clearing your throat – a sound that's pretty unique to Dutch! Getting your tongue around these new sounds can be tricky, but the alphabet song helps you practice these pronunciations in a repetitive and memorable way. Each time you sing along, you’re not just memorizing letters; you're also training your mouth to form new sounds. This repetition is key to mastering the sounds of Dutch. Think of it like learning to play a musical instrument; the more you practice, the better you become. The Dutch alphabet song is like your daily vocal exercise, preparing you for more complex words and sentences.

Key Features of a Good Dutch Alphabet Song
Okay, so what makes a good Dutch alphabet song? Here's the lowdown:
When you're on the hunt for the perfect Dutch alphabet song, keep an ear out for clear pronunciation. This is non-negotiable. You want to make sure that the singer is articulating each letter correctly, with the proper Dutch sounds. Incorrect pronunciation can lead to bad habits that are difficult to break later on. Pay attention to how the vowels are pronounced, as these can differ significantly from English. For example, the Dutch 'a' is pronounced differently than the English 'a,' and the 'e' can have several different pronunciations depending on the word. A good alphabet song will highlight these nuances and provide clear examples. Another crucial element is the melody. A catchy tune can make all the difference in how well you remember the alphabet. Think of it like your favorite pop song; you can sing along without even thinking about it because the melody is so ingrained in your memory. The same principle applies to the alphabet song. A memorable melody will help you internalize the letters and sounds, making it easier to recall them later. Look for songs that have a simple, upbeat tune that you can easily sing along to.
Visual aids are also incredibly helpful, especially for visual learners. A video that shows the letters as they are sung can reinforce the connection between the sound and the written form. This is particularly useful for letters that have similar sounds in English, as the visual representation can help you differentiate them. Additionally, visual aids can make the learning process more engaging and entertaining, especially for children. Consider songs that feature colorful animations or playful characters to keep you or your little ones interested. Finally, repetition is the cornerstone of memorization. A good alphabet song will repeat the letters and sounds multiple times throughout the song. This repetition helps to solidify the information in your brain, making it easier to recall when you need it. Look for songs that not only repeat the letters in order but also incorporate them into simple words or phrases. This can help you understand how the letters are used in context and improve your overall comprehension of the Dutch language. Tips for Maximizing Your Learning
Alright, you've found your song. Now what? Here are some tips to supercharge your learning:
Once you've discovered the perfect Dutch alphabet song that resonates with your learning style, it's time to take your language acquisition journey to the next level. Simply listening to the song passively won't be enough to truly master the alphabet; you need to actively engage with the material and incorporate it into your daily routine. One of the most effective ways to supercharge your learning is to sing along with the song. Don't just listen silently; open your mouth and belt out the lyrics! Singing actively engages your brain and helps you remember the letters more effectively. As you sing, focus on pronouncing each letter correctly, paying attention to the unique sounds of the Dutch language. This will not only improve your pronunciation but also enhance your overall comprehension of the alphabet.
Consistency is also crucial for long-term retention. Make it a habit to listen to the Dutch alphabet song every day, even if it's just for a few minutes. Repetition is key when it comes to memorizing new information, and the more you listen to the song, the more ingrained the letters and sounds will become in your memory. Consider incorporating the song into your morning routine, your commute, or your study sessions. You can even play it in the background while you're doing chores or other activities. The key is to make it a regular part of your life so that you're constantly reinforcing your knowledge of the Dutch alphabet. Another effective technique is to practice writing the letters as you sing along with the song. This will help you connect the sound of each letter with its written form, making it easier to recognize and recall them later. Grab a pen and paper and write out the letters in order as you sing along with the song. Pay attention to the shape and form of each letter, and try to mimic the handwriting style in the song. This will not only improve your handwriting skills but also reinforce your understanding of the Dutch alphabet.
Flashcards can also be a valuable tool for memorizing the Dutch alphabet. Create flashcards with the Dutch letters on one side and their pronunciations on the other side. Use these flashcards to quiz yourself regularly, testing your knowledge of the letters and their sounds. You can also use the flashcards to practice spelling Dutch words, using the alphabet as a guide. Flashcards are a portable and versatile learning tool that you can use anytime, anywhere. Carry them with you on the go, and use them to quiz yourself during your downtime.
